The application provides the chance for a detailed training in forensic mental health. It covers the theoretical and practical facets of civil, criminal, child and family forensic mental wellbeing sub specialities. It is undertaken on a parttime basis. It is designed for mental health care professionals including medical practitioners, nurses, psychologists, social workers and occupational therapists. The application can be also available for members of the legal profession, corrections, police and criminologists. It is taught by distance delivery and provides video chats, online forums and internet activities.
